diff options
Diffstat (limited to 'src/auditor/taler-auditor-httpd_exchanges.c')
-rw-r--r-- | src/auditor/taler-auditor-httpd_exchanges.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/src/auditor/taler-auditor-httpd_exchanges.c b/src/auditor/taler-auditor-httpd_exchanges.c index 7b54b6d4..f9a9e9e6 100644 --- a/src/auditor/taler-auditor-httpd_exchanges.c +++ b/src/auditor/taler-auditor-httpd_exchanges.c @@ -75,15 +75,14 @@ TAH_EXCHANGES_handler (struct TAH_RequestHandler *rh, size_t *upload_data_size) { json_t *ja; - struct TALER_AUDITORDB_Session *session; enum GNUNET_DB_QueryStatus qs; (void) rh; (void) connection_cls; (void) upload_data; (void) upload_data_size; - session = TAH_plugin->get_session (TAH_plugin->cls); - if (NULL == session) + if (GNUNET_SYSERR == + TAH_plugin->preflight (TAH_plugin->cls)) { GNUNET_break (0); return TALER_MHD_reply_with_error (connection, @@ -94,7 +93,6 @@ TAH_EXCHANGES_handler (struct TAH_RequestHandler *rh, ja = json_array (); GNUNET_break (NULL != ja); qs = TAH_plugin->list_exchanges (TAH_plugin->cls, - session, &add_exchange, ja); if (0 > qs) |